深入理解Python编程思维

版权申诉
0 下载量 141 浏览量 更新于2024-11-02 收藏 925KB ZIP 举报
资源摘要信息:"《Think Python 中文版》是一本由Allen B. Downey撰写的编程入门书籍。该书的英文原名为'Think Python: How to Think Like a Computer Scientist',中文版则是针对Python语言的入门教程,旨在帮助初学者通过Python语言的学习培养计算思维和编程基础。本书适合完全没有编程经验的读者阅读,也被广泛用作大学一年级计算机科学的入门教材。 《Think Python 中文版》详细介绍了Python的基础知识,包括但不限于变量、表达式、语句、函数、数据结构、模块、类和对象等。作者通过简洁明了的语言和生动的例子,使读者能够快速掌握Python编程的基本概念和技能。 书中不仅注重理论知识的讲解,还强调了实践操作的重要性,鼓励读者通过编写代码来加深理解。此外,Allen B. Downey在书中融入了计算机科学的基本原理和最佳实践,帮助读者在学习编程的同时,理解计算机程序是如何工作的。 本书还介绍了一些高级主题,比如异常处理、文件处理、列表解析、生成器等,这些内容能够帮助读者在掌握基础知识之后,进一步提升编程能力。对于那些希望通过学习Python来进入编程世界的读者来说,《Think Python 中文版》是一个极好的起点。 在阅读本书的过程中,读者会发现作者不断引导大家像计算机科学家一样思考问题,这是本书与其他入门书籍不同的地方。Allen B. Downey认为编程不仅仅是一种技术技能,更是一种解决问题和抽象思维的方式。通过阅读这本书,读者不仅可以学会Python编程语言,更重要的是能够学会如何思考问题,将复杂的问题分解成可以管理的小问题,并通过编写程序来解决它们。 《Think Python 中文版》的另一个特色是其结构编排。全书分为多个章节,每章都包含了相应的练习题,方便读者在学习过程中巩固和测试自己的知识。这种互动式的学习方式有助于提高学习效率,并且能够促进读者的主动学习。 最后,本书的中文版是完全免费的电子书格式,读者可以通过下载'《Think Python 中文版》.zip'文件来获得PDF格式的电子书。这意味着读者不需要花费任何费用就能接触到高质量的编程教育内容,这在提高编程教育普及率方面起到了积极作用。"